Finally had my first bottle of Antoine Jobard but I did not find it anywhere as exciting as some have claimed. Decent winemaking showing rounded creamy tree fruits, not the lean and reductive style yet not exuberant enough to be memorable. Inexpensive for a Meursault 1er Cru but not the best value either. Typical 2010 white Chardonnay character of rich fruits and high alcohol, a vintage that buyers should be careful about. (85/100)

Attractive aromas - honey on toast, lemon, peach, oatmeal. The palate is firm but generous. There's a wonderful salinity that is balanced by the sweetness of the fruit. The oak is measured and is carried well by the fruit. The overall effect is delicious. Drinking well now, but could easily hold.
